1.
mining; extraction; quarrying
digging out minerals, ores, or natural resources from the earth for commercial use
石炭を採掘する。
To mine coal.
この地域では金の採掘が行われていた。
Gold mining was conducted in this area.
採掘権をめぐって争いが起きた。
A dispute arose over mining rights.
環境への影響から採掘が制限されている。
Mining is restricted due to environmental impact.
採掘 refers specifically to mining or extracting natural resources from the earth for commercial purposes.
KANJI BREAKDOWN:
- 採 (gather, collect, take)
- 掘 (dig)
USAGE:
- 採掘する (to mine - suru verb)
- 採掘権 (mining rights)
- 採掘場 (mining site)
COMMON OBJECTS:
- 石炭の採掘 (coal mining)
- 金の採掘 (gold mining)
- 石油の採掘 (oil extraction)
- 鉱石の採掘 (ore mining)
- 天然ガスの採掘 (natural gas extraction)
CONTRAST:
- 発掘: archaeological excavation or talent discovery
- 採掘: commercial extraction of natural resources
- 掘削: drilling (often for oil/gas wells)
